Franklin committee readies for Ethos art festival, votes to sponsor Canvas Clash artist
Summary
The Franklin City Community Arts Committee discussed logistics for the Ethos art festival, including artist counts, vendor services, volunteer shifts and a $100 sponsorship for a Canvas Clash artist, and noted a sharp rise in farmers market attendance.
The Franklin City Community Arts Committee voted to sponsor a Canvas Clash artist and discussed logistics for the upcoming Ethos art festival, including artist totals, vendor services, volunteer staffing and related events.
Committee members said the Ethos weekend will run roughly 10 a.m. to 4 p.m.; programming will include live music throughout the day, a beer-and-wine garden, a shaded Chalk-the-Block area hosted by Festival Country and cross-promotion with a Secret Garden Walk organized by Franklin Heritage.
